I'm Tamieko Graves Rogers, an experienced Behavioral Health Clinician deeply passionate about empowering individuals to thrive in their mental health and wellness journey. With over two decades of dedicated experience in counseling, therapy, and mental health support, I've had the privilege of guiding diverse populations towards healing and growth. Throughout my career, I've been driven by a profound commitment to compassion, advocacy, and evidence-based practices. I believe in fostering a safe and supportive environment where individuals can explore their challenges, uncover their strengths, and embark on a path towards holistic well-being.
During our first session, we will get to know each other and discuss your goals and what you would like to be different once you have completed treatment.
My greatest strength is meeting my patients where they are and to be a safe place for them to work out their issues. To also treat them from a holistic approach, taking into account mental and social factors, rather than just the symptoms of an illness.
I love working with children and adults who experience problems with anxious behaviors, mood, or emotional dysregulation. Once identified, we work together to focus on increasing strategies and skills and to decrease symptoms.
